About N-[2-[1,3-benzodioxol-5-yl-[(1R)-2-(2-methylbutan-2-ylamino)-1-(4-methylphenyl)-2-oxoethyl]amino]-2-oxoethyl]thiophene-2-carboxamide

N-[2-[1,3-benzodioxol-5-yl-[(1R)-2-(2-methylbutan-2-ylamino)-1-(4-methylphenyl)-2-oxoethyl]amino]-2-oxoethyl]thiophene-2-carboxamide (PubChem CID 25317120) has the molecular formula C28H31N3O5S and a molecular weight of 521.64 g/mol. Its IUPAC name is N-[2-[1,3-benzodioxol-5-yl-[(1R)-2-(2-methylbutan-2-ylamino)-1-(4-methylphenyl)-2-oxoethyl]amino]-2-oxoethyl]thiophene-2-carboxamide.
